Elion doubles IP capacity to expand broadband services

23 Feb 2005

Estonia’s dominant telco Elion Enterprises reports that its IP capacity has doubled through a project carried out with long term infrastructure partner Teleglobe. The work involved setting up dedicated access to Teleglobe’s internet backbone which is directly connected to over 90 countries. Elion is aiming to increase its consumer broadband subscriber base substantially again this year, following a 50% rise in its DSL users in 2004. The company claimed to have over 60% of the total internet access market at the end of last year.
